    Thanks for sharing, not a bad idea for people to get a check up every year or two especially when getting closer to 40.

    P.s. Just because you are type 2 does not mean you will never need insulin. Over time your body's natural insulin production may wane, in which case pills will no longer work.

    P.s. P.s. Make you sure you get your eyes checked yearly by an ophthalmologist, uncontrolled diabetes is one the leading causes of blindness.
